        Most Spanish colonies were glorified plantations producing only one or few cash crops. So when they became independent, they also found themselves with an economy revolving around a single or limited number of products. And their product(s) no longer had a globe spanning empire keeping their trade in balance. Also, every governor was appointed directly by the court in Madrid and every wealthy colonial son went to Spain for higher education. So now the plantation owners, with no experience in governance or innovation, but plenty of experience in cracking whips, found themselves completely in charge.

        Banking on exports. It incentivized the upper-classes to lower wages as much as possible to pump out cheap product for European consumption. It created a population to poor to be a viable market for industrial goods and the landowners wouldn’t even want to invest in industry anyway. So the infrastructure remained backwards and their industry became dominated by foreigners, particular the British. Industrialization was the primary engine of wealth in the 20th century and Latin-America had to play catch up for decades. Argentina should have been a world superpower but instead it’s a state that’s barely relevant because it’s leadership kept the focus on investing mining and farming.
